‘Gruha Himsa’ Case Against Yuvraj Singh
Indian cricketer Yuvraj Singh’s sister-in-law Akanksha Sharma has filed a domestic violence (Gruha Himsa)case against him and his family members. She allegedly accused her in-laws of causing her mental and financial torture.
In her complaint, Akanksha accused her mother-in-law and husband of pressuring her to conceive, and also subjecting her to mental and financial torture. Including Yuvraj’s name in her compliant, she allegedly accused him of taking the side of his family members.
According to reports, Gurugram Police have booked Akanksha’s husband Zoravar Singh, mother-in-law Shabnam and brother-in-law Yuvraj Singh in the case. And, a notice has been sent to Yuvraj Singh’s family in this regard. The case will come for hearing on October 21, say reports.
YCP Leader Sharmila’ s Son Kidnapped & Released
An unidentified person has abducted YSR Congress Party floor leader in Rajamahendravaram Municipal Corporation Sharmila Reddy’s 10 year old son. However the boy managed to escape from the clutches of the abductor.
Sharmila along with her son Siddarth Reddy came to her home after attending a programme in her restaurant. When she went inside house to pick her daughter, an unidentified man kidnapped son by driving away the YSR Congress leader’s car. Sharmila alerted police and local people and launched hunt.
When the kidnapper slowed down the car at Prakasham Nagar, the boy jumped from out of the vehicle. On seeing the boy, Sharmila and family members heaved a sigh of relief. The kidnapper also left the car 40 km away from Rajamahendravaram. And she found the car based on a letter left behind near her house.

Day 1: Raja Collects 10 Cr
Mass majaraja Ravi Teja’s “Raja The Great” is off to a terrific start at the worldwide box-office as it grossed over Rs 10 Cr. The opening is highly commendable considering the film was released mid-week and amidst pre-festival hullabaloo.
The commercial entertainer has raked in Rs 7.8 crore from the Telugu states and over Rs 10 Cr from the worldwide box office. The Ravi Teja-starrer collected around $130K from US premieres, the career best for the actor.
Area-wise break-up of distributor share:
Nizam – 1,95,00,000
Ceded – 85,00,000
Nellore – 16,50,000
Guntur – 50,00,000
Krishna – 28,47,051
West – 30,19,086
East – 40,25,921
Uttharandhra – 59,50,000
Total 1st day AP & TS share – 5.05 Cr (Gross – 7.8Cr)
Total 1st day Worldwide share – 6.5 Cr (Gross – 10 Cr)

TDP Splits Into Anti Revanth & Pro Revanth Groups
TDP Telangana unit Working President A Revanth Reddy’s reported decision to switch loyalties to Congress stirred a political storm within the yellow party .
The Telugu Desam split vertically into two groups – ‘Anti Revanth and Pro Revanth.’ The anti revanth group was headed by politburo member Mothkupalli Narasimhulu.
Mothkupalli has been opposing Revanth proposal to sail the TDP along with Congress in the next elections. The politburo member was demanding party high command joining hands with TRS only.
Senior leaders R Prakash Reddy, R Chandrasekhar Reddy, Chada Suresh Reddy, M Amarnath Babu and MLA S Venkata Veeriah strongly condemned Revanth’s anti party activities. The other leaders – V Narendar Reddy, K Dayakar Reddy and E Ramana were supporting Revanth.
On the insistence of the anti Revanth group, the party high command would take disciplinary action against Revanth in a week or ten days. Before that, the party is mulling to serve a show cause notice on the leader. Giving a clear indication that action against Revanth is imminent, Ramana in a statement warned the leaders from state to village level not to make anti party comments as TDP Chief already decided to discuss poll alliances with other parties only during the elections.

What’s wrong in TDP leader touching KCR feet?
Within hours after making serious comments against Seemandhra Telugu Desam Party counterparts for succumbing to Telangana Rashtra Samithi president and chief minister K Chandrasekhar Rao, Telangana TDP leader A Revanth Reddy started receiving brickbats.
The strong criticism against Revanth was from Paritala Sriram, son of Andhra minister Paritala Sunitha, whose marriage triggered all the trouble in the Telangana TDP. In his posting on his Facebook page, Sriram targeted Revanth for being too ambitious to become the chief minister and blaming the party leaders from Seemandhra.
“KCR is a good old friend of our family. When he came to my marriage and blessed me, I touched his feet. What’s wrong in it? Why do you view even a marriage in political angle? Didn’t you ever invite leaders of rival parties to weddings and other functions in your family? Didn’t you ever go the weddings of other party leaders?” he asked.
Sriram alleged that for the last one year, Revanth had been systematically trying to build up an anti-TRS forum by joining hands with the Congress party and when everything came under his control, he was now finding excuses to desert the TDP.
“You are creating an impression the Congress party is stronger than the TDP in Telangana,” he said.
Another Telangana TDP leader and party general secretary Aravind Kumar Goud also found fault with Revanth Reddy for making allegations against Andhra TDP leaders in a bid to cover up his attempts to join the Congress party.
“Nothing will happen to the TDP, even if Revanth leaves. It continues to remain a strong political party,” Goud said.
